Long story short, I paid a 3rd party service to unlock my phone. I have a feeling they won't unlock it before I leave the country so I won't have a computer to restore my iPhone.

When I last unlocked my iPhone 5, I had to restore it through iTunes to get it to work.

If the 3rd party service I used unlocks the phone after I've already left the country, how would I activate the unlock?
 
You do not need iTunes. Once the 3rd party informs of the unlock, it's on Apples severs. Just insert new carriers SIM card and if unlocked you will see it activate. If it's not yet unlocked you will see invalid SIM.
